If you have an old GameCube that is not working properly, there are several steps you can take to try to fix it:
Check the connections: Make sure all the cables and wires are connected properly. Ensure that the AC adapter is plugged in properly and that the AV cables are connected securely to the TV.
Clean the GameCube: Over time, the GameCube's internal components and the outside casing can accumulate dust and grime. You can use a soft cloth or compressed air to clean the GameCube and its internal components.
Clean the GameCube lens: If the GameCube is having trouble reading game discs, the lens may be dirty or dusty. You can use a lens cleaning kit to clean the lens.
Replace the AC adapter: If the GameCube is not turning on or is experiencing power problems, the AC adapter may be faulty. You can try replacing the AC adapter with a new one.
Replace the GameCube controller: If the GameCube controller is not working properly, you may need to replace it. You can purchase a new controller online or from a gaming store.
Repair the GameCube: If the above steps do not work, the GameCube may be experiencing more serious problems, such as a faulty motherboard or disc drive. In this case, you may need to take the GameCube to a repair shop or purchase a new one.
